很多集群实现的高可用方式是通过keeplive+nginx实现的高可用,方式是利用keeplived来监控nginx的主备,通过vip对外提供服务,但是这个针对master要求至少两台即可,而我今天使...
k8s中部署哨兵集群sentinel无法解析容器名
在部署redis哨兵模式集群时,因为需要sentinel进行监控redis进行进行master节点转移,刚装好后,发现确实集群正常了,但是在测试时sentinel一直无法找到实例名称,看一下我的配置。...
kubernetes中部署redis哨兵模式集群
在部署redis哨兵模式集群之前,先看一下需要做哪些准备,因为redis默认镜像中是没有哨兵模式的,所以需要把定义好的配置放到镜像中,这里需要两个配置文件分别是redis的配置文件和哨兵模式的配置文件...
Kubernetes 中的 NetworkPolicy:原理和应用
摘要:Kubernetes 是一个强大的容器编排平台,通过 NetworkPolicy 功能可以实现对容器网络流量的精细控制。本文将介绍 Kubernetes 中 NetworkPolicy 的原理和...
理解Kubernetes中的Ingress Class
简介 在Kubernetes中,Ingress Class是一种非常有用的机制,它允许开发人员和运维人员通过定义不同的Ingress Class来控制和管理不同的Ingress资源。本文将介绍Ingr...
containerd基本下的k8s环境拉取镜像失败
在给予containerd下的k8s环境,在拉取私有镜像时,总是会请求https,因为是私有网络,所以也没有使用https,不管harbor的443端口开还是不开,都是请求超时的异常,这个在以前是没有...
kubernetes部署高可用集群
kubernetes的主要组件是etcd,kube-apiserver,kube-scheduler和kube-controller-manager。如果在多个master节点中利用负载均衡的方式把组...
ingress报错414 Request-URI Too Large
刚出现问题的时候我一直认为是我的nginx的配置问题,但是看了配置文件以为是配置的低了,就修改了一下参数,但是还是一样的报错,搞了半天,一直没解决,后来不使用域名解析的时候发现是可以的,怀疑的点是我的...
kubernetes中通过ingress转发到nginx获取ip
先说一下我的情况,我的环境是通过slb转发到ingress,然后在ingress中通过路由转发到nginx,在nginx配置反向代理到不同的服务,首先,我的ingress能够获取到用户的真是IP,但是...
K8s通过SidecarSet进行日志收集
日志做了等级分类,日志就会有多个文件,以前写了一个日志收集的方法主要是针对日志输出到stout然后通过filebate利用Daemonset在每个节点上起一个容器,然后收集写到宿主机上的日志内容,这种...